    Beskrivning

    Industrial Applications of Nanomaterials explains the industry based applications of nanomaterials, along with their environmental impacts, lifecycle analysis, safety and sustainability. This book brings together the industrial applications of nanomaterials with the incorporation of various technologies and areas, covering new trends and challenges. Significant properties, safety and sustainability and environmental impacts of synthesis routes are also explored, as are major industrial applications, including agriculture, medicine, communication, construction, energy, and in the military. This book is an important information source for those in research and development who want to gain a greater understanding of how nanotechnology is being used to create cheaper, more efficient products.



    • Explains how different classes of nanomaterials are being used to create cheaper, more efficient products
    • Explores the environmental impacts of using a variety of nanomaterials
    • Discusses the challenges faced by engineers looking to integrate nanotechnology in new product development

    Mer om författaren

    Professor Sabu Thomas is currently an Emeritus Professor of Mahatma Gandhi University, Kottayam, Kerala, India. He was the former Vice Chancellor of Mahatma Gandhi University. He is a Senior Professor of Christ University, Bangalore, India. He is also a visiting Professor at the Department of Chemical Sciences, University of Johannesburg, Johannesburg, South Africa, Department of Chemical Engineering, Faculty of Engineering, Chulalongkorn University, Bangkok, Thailand, and an Adjunct Faculty in the Department of Polymer and Process Engineering, IIT Roorkee, India. He is the Chairman of the TrEST Research Park, Trivandrum, Kerala, India. The H index of Professor Thomas is 163 and he has more than 133,000 citationsProfessor Yves Grohens is the Director of the LIMATB (Material Engineering) Laboratory of Université de Bretagne Sud, France. His master's and PhD degrees were from Besançon University, France. After finishing his studies, he worked as assistant professor and later professor in various reputed universities in France. He is an invited professor to many universities in different parts of the world as well. His areas of interest include physicochemical studies of polymer surfaces and interfaces, phase transitions in thin films confinement, nano and bio composites design and characterization, and biodegradation of polymers and biomaterials. He has written several book chapters, monographs, and scientific reviews and has published 130 international publications. He is the chairman and member of advisory committees of many international conferences. Dr. Yasir Beeran Pottathara is a scientific associate at Rudolfovo-Science and Technology Center, Novo Mesto, Slovenia. He has over 10 years of research experience in nanocomposites and materials, with special focus on nanocellulose multifunctional composites, 2D nanomaterials, and porous materials to advance the performance in the field of energy storage and flexible electronics. He has authored more than 30 publications, including original research articles and review papers with the Royal Society of Chemistry (RSC), American Chemical Society (ACS), Elsevier, Springer, and Wiley-VCH. He has edited or co-edited several books published by Elsevier - Micro and Nano technologies.

    Innehållsförteckning

    • 1. Nanomaterials for Industry2. Nanomaterials as Surfaces and Coatings3. Applications of Nanomaterials in Textile Industry4. Nanomaterials for Cosmetics5. Nanomaterials for Sports6. Nanomaterials for Aerospace Applications7. Nanomaterials for Automotive Industry8. Nanomaterials for Military9. Nanomaterials Applications in Food Industry10. Application of Nanomaterials in Agricultural Production and Crop Protection11. Nanomaterials for Water Treatment12. Nanomaterials in Construction Industry13. Nanomaterials for Catalysis14. Nanomaterials for Nanoelectronics15. Nanomaterials for Information and Communication Technology 16. Nanomaterials for Batteries17. Nanomaterials for Sensors18. Nanomaterials for Fuel cells19. Nanomaterials for Medicine20. Nanomaterials for Drug Delivery21. Nanomaterials for Medical Imaging 22. Nanomaterials for Medical Implants
